This is a great book with lots of info. A friend loaned us an older version of this book, which made me decide to get this version for my son's AP Biology class. It helped him a lot, since the book chosen by the school was not really as good for an AP Class. As a Biologist myself, I recommend this book to anyone who will dedicate the time to study the book. It is not an easy book, but it is very good. It has plenty of information, maybe a lot more than needed for an AP Class, but very good foundation for someone who shoots for a career in the areas of biology or Medicine.

Just in case you bought one with CD, the CD installation software starts with Windows IE4 software installation. It would not work on most of the computers nowadays. However, the activities and quizzes are still valuable. They are in html format which can be opened with the latest Windows IE version or another internet browser such as Firefox. Just skip the installation software and open \home\home.htm file on the CD directly with the browser. Here is what I did in Windows XP, go to My Computer and click on View, Explorer Bar, Folders. Open the folder under your CD/DVD drive and drill down to "home" folder and double click to open home.htm. It should open automatically via the internet browser.

Hands down, Campbell's Biology is the most beautifully written and illustrated biology textbook on the market and has remained so through many, many editions. I am a plant biologist and was pleased to see that even at the introductory level, this book gave plant life equal prominence with animal biology. If you want to fall in love with biology, this is the text to get you there. Campbell and Reese accompanied me through freshman biology, every upper level undergrad and graduate biology course I took, and finally served as an indispensable reference when studying for my qualifying examinations. I don't currently teach intro bio, but if and when I do, Campbell and Reese will lead my selections for the textbook.
